Recognizing Open hernia Surgical TreatmentWhen you take into consideration open hernia surgery, it's important to understand what the procedure involves. This sort of surgical procedure entails making a bigger cut near the hernia site, enabling your specialist straight access to the damaged area.
Once they find the hernia, they'll push the protruding cells back right into area and repair the muscular tissue wall surface, usually utilizing mesh to reinforce it. The surgical procedure generally takes regarding one to 2 hours, and you'll generally be under general anesthesia.
After the treatment, you can anticipate a recuperation period that might last a few weeks, throughout which you'll require to prevent hefty lifting or difficult tasks.
Open hernia surgical treatment can effectively attend to different hernia kinds, providing enduring relief and preventing reappearance.
Discovering Laparoscopic hernia SurgeryLaparoscopic hernia surgery offers a minimally invasive option to open surgical procedure. This strategy enables much less cells interruption and typically leads to less postoperative pain.
You'll appreciate the quicker recovery time, which suggests you can go back to your day-to-day tasks earlier. Lots of patients experience decreased scarring contrasted to standard techniques, improving cosmetic outcomes.
Furthermore, laparoscopic surgical treatment typically results in shorter health center stays, sometimes also enabling outpatient procedures. It's crucial to review your certain situation with your cosmetic surgeon to understand just how this technique can benefit you.
Variables to Consider When Picking a Surgical TechniqueChoosing a surgical technique for hernia fixing hinges on several vital factors that can substantially impact your recovery and results.
First, consider the type and dimension of your hernia; larger or a lot more complex ruptures might take advantage of an open strategy.
Next off, think of your overall health and wellness and any kind of pre-existing problems. If you have respiratory concerns or cardio issues, laparoscopic surgical procedure may be less high-risk.
Healing time is an additional critical factor; laparoscopic methods frequently use quicker recuperation, allowing you to return to everyday tasks earlier.
Finally, review your cosmetic surgeon's experience with both techniques, as their experience can affect your results.
Make certain to evaluate these factors carefully before making a decision that's right for you.
